No, that is a compatibility setting for older 4D versions where time values were converted to milliseconds instead of seconds. Hoping some day there will be an option to just use time values instead of numbers. That was done for dates (instead of strings), seems like it should be possible for time. The type conversion rules for objects and collections seem crazy and inconsistent.
